Leadership Review Briefing — Harlow Term Sheet

Quick one for the sales leads: Harlow & Brisk sent over their term sheet for the Castwick distribution deal. Terms are better than expected — exclusivity is regional only, and margins hold. We're pushing back on the renewal clause. Context on where this fits our plans is below.

internal memo for kawip-hadug: Headcount on the Wenwyn team goes from 7 to 140 by the end of January. Gross margin on Wenwyn came in at 20 percent against a plan of 15 percent.

Handover — Annual Billing Transition

To the incoming director: Pellarch Software shifts all subscriptions to annual billing effective next fiscal year. Monthly plans close to new signups in March. Migration discounts approved for legacy accounts; churn modeling done by the Ralbeck team, worst case 6%. Finance tooling update is mid-build — chase the Ardenfold group weekly or it slips. Renewal comms drafted, not sent. Legal cleared terms. Everything else is in the shared tracker. One last item follows below, and it stays between us.

board note of kagaf-tahog: Ulaoxek Systems is in early talks to buy Ralokek Group for about $329.6 million. The Wenys launch date is September 16, and nothing goes to the press before then. Legal wants the Keloxox Foods term sheet signed before June 7.

Handover note — Crumbwheel order cutoffs.

Welcome aboard. The bakery cutoff rule in Crumbwheel closes same-day orders at 14:00 local to each storefront, not UTC — this has bitten us twice. Holiday overrides live in the calendar service and take precedence silently, so always check there first when a cutoff looks wrong. To unlock the calendar service's admin console after a restart, enter the recovery passphrase below.

vault phrase of bagap-bahaf = silion-pelox-sorox-casdor-quenwyn-fraax-eliox-praael-kelion-quenvan-kasox-rusael-norius-belvan

Looks good overall. One ask from support's side: the `tailcat` CLI should surface its effective buffer and poll settings in `--verbose` output, since we keep guessing why tails lag during Quillmere incidents. Also please document the reconnect behavior in the help text. The defaults this change ships with are listed here.

tuning table, yajog-yahof:
BUDGETS = {
    "lamvan": 303,
    "wenox": 460,
    "fenvan": 525,
}